Pesco seizes illegally installed power transformer


LAKKI MARWAT - Pesco officials seized a transformer illegally installed in Gandi Khankhel area during a raid on Monday.
“The raid was carried out on the directives of executive engineer Jamalud Din after receiving information that some households in the locality were using electricity through illegally installed power transformer”, said line superintendent Misal Khan.
He said that Pesco team headed by SDO Fareed Khan along with police party of Shaheed Asmatullah Khan Khattak police station of Naurang Town seized the transformer and initiated legal action against power stealers. He said that the drive against electricity thieves and defaulters was in full swing in the entire district and it would be made result oriented.
“The menace of power theft will be eliminated besides all out efforts will be made to improve recoveries from defaulters”, he quoted Xen Jamalud Din as saying. He added that executive engineer Jamalud Din had called upon area elders to cooperate with Pesco teams to achieve the target of curbing power theft and improving recoveries.
Meanwhile, Tanzeem Lissail Wal Mehroom held a cheque distribution ceremony in district council hall at the district headquarters complex Tajazai on Monday.
Deputy Commission Nisar Ahmad was the chief guest on the occasion. TLWM assistant manager health Muhammad Azizur Rehman, ESED focal person Akram Khan and representatives of teachers’ organisations were in the attendance.
DC Nisar distributed cheques worth Rs 157,8000 among orphan students of schools. He appreciated Tanzeem’s efforts it was making to help orphan students to continue their education.
“By receiving financial assistance from government the families of orphan students will not face any problems to get their children equipped with quality education”, he maintained.
He called upon the students to concentrate on their studies and enable themselves to meet future challenges in a better was besides taking the country to the climax of progress.
